Abstract

Background:Atypical forms of pityriasis rosea are often noticed in Indian children.Main observations:We describe a 9-year-old male child with predominant follicular eruptions on trunk consistent with a clinical diagnosis of pityriasis rosea.Conclusion:Follicular pityriasis rosea is an extremely rare presentation of the disease. We propose a new classification of clinical variants of pityriasis rosea.
